logo

Output e3dad3b0299884ec7ef755bb7c9cba3f25a56b0a5af1e24851cc492b39401ab6:2

value
3139622
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 886bfdc1a34cccfe2a9fda3e67345b06f96d9e62 OP_EQUALVERIFY OP_CHECKSIG
address
1DSLGTC2GEvzWxvtgsua3g78HCykhiWQAd
transaction
e3dad3b0299884ec7ef755bb7c9cba3f25a56b0a5af1e24851cc492b39401ab6